✅ 1. What is the difference between Saxenda, Wegovy, and Mounjaro?

Saxenda and Wegovy
stimulate only one hormone,
GLP-1.
Mounjaro is different.
It is a dual receptor agonist that
simultaneously stimulates two hormones,
GLP-1 and GIP.
It is like the difference between a car with one engine
and a car with two engines.
The reason it has much stronger effects
than existing medications on appetite suppression and metabolic improvement
is exactly here.
✅ 2. How much weight can you lose?

Based on clinical results,
with the highest dose, over about one year,
body weight decreased by about 20–22%.
That is a number
almost comparable to gastric bypass surgery.
However, gastric bypass surgery is relatively permanent,
whereas with Mounjaro,
if you stop taking the medication,
the effect is not maintained.
You should definitely understand this difference
before starting.
✅ 3. Do you have to inject it every day?

No, it is once a week.
Compared with Saxenda, which had to be injected every day,
this is much more convenient,
and that is a major advantage of Mounjaro.
It is made as a dedicated pen type,
so the needle is barely visible
and the pain is minimal, making it not difficult to inject yourself.
✅ 4. Is it true that nausea and vomiting are severe?

It is true that digestive side effects
are the most common.
In the beginning, you may feel nauseous,
or develop diarrhea or constipation.
However, if you start with a very low dose
and increase it slowly,
most people can adjust as their body adapts.
The key is not to raise the dose too quickly.
✅ 5. Will rebound weight gain happen immediately if you stop?

I’ll be honest.
If you stop the medication and return to your previous eating habits,
your weight will increase again.
Mounjaro is only a tool.
During the period when your weight is decreasing,
it is important to build healthy eating and exercise habits
into your body.
That is the only way
to prevent rebound weight gain.
✅ 6. Can the injection site become itchy or swollen?

There may be pain or redness
at the injection site.
In most cases, this is a temporary immune response,
so there is usually no need to worry too much.
However, if there is tenderness when touched,
it may be a sign of infection.
In that case, please consult a medical professional right away.
✅ 7. Can it be prescribed for weight loss even if you do not have diabetes?

According to domestic MFDS standards,
it can be prescribed to patients with obesity based on BMI,
or to overweight patients with weight-related comorbidities.
Whether a prescription is actually possible
will be confirmed through an in-person consultation.
✅ 8. What if I lose muscle too?

With rapid weight loss,
muscle loss may also occur.
To prevent this,
maintaining a high-protein diet and
combining it with strength training are essential.

✅ 10. Is it true that there is a risk of pancreatitis or thyroid cancer?

Although it is a very rare case,
if you have a history of pancreatitis,
extra caution is relatively necessary.
The same goes for people with thyroid disease.
There is no absolute contraindication,
but if you have diabetes or a past history of pancreatitis,
a thorough medical history review before the procedure is absolutely necessary.
✅ 11. Can it be used while preparing for pregnancy or while breastfeeding?

It is not recommended.
If you are planning to become pregnant,
it is safer to wait at least 2 months after the treatment ends
before trying to conceive.

✅ 13. Can I drink alcohol?

Drinking itself is not a contraindication.
However, because it can burden the pancreas,
we recommend limiting alcohol as much as possible.
Alcohol and side dishes are high in calories,
and late-night eating puts a lot of strain on the body,
so it can slow down weight loss.
